Output 76abc78c45c16df85dabe6a4baa2c56db74a21c0dc902b57118c49907713e648:1

value
85905002
script pubkey
OP_0 OP_PUSHBYTES_20 3bd31506b98fc0b941ab18fd35cf8ebc6badd309
address
bc1q80f32p4e3lqtjsdtrr7ntnuwh346m5cfcsm5hk
transaction
76abc78c45c16df85dabe6a4baa2c56db74a21c0dc902b57118c49907713e648